Rotary Kiln Preheater Cost in Uganda: Budget Guide

Lina Published 9 min read

Budget a rotary kiln and preheater line for Uganda from the live local anchor: Yaobai’s Moroto plant, a USD 300 million integrated project whose first-phase 6,000 tonne-per-day clinker line was commissioned on 24 April 2026. A kiln and preheater package on its own prices well below a full-plant figure like that, and every number in this guide is indicative until sized against your tonnage and fuel plan.

Until this year, Ugandan kiln pricing was inferred from regional proxies. Now a commissioned Ugandan reference and two recent Kenyan contracts bracket the market from both sides. Three verified price anchors for a clinker line

Start with contracts that exist, not vendor brochures. Three recent, publicly reported East African projects give the honest range for integrated clinker capacity.

ProjectScopeCapacityReported figureStatus
Yaobai Moroto, UgandaIntegrated plant, phase one6,000 t/day clinkerUSD 300M project investmentCommissioned Apr 2026
Bamburi Kwale, KenyaFull turnkey EPC1.6Mt/yr clinkerUSD 250M contractSigned Dec 2025
Cemtech Sebit, KenyaIntegrated plant6,000 t/day clinkerUSD 345M investmentCommissioned Apr 2024

The Kwale number is the cleanest comparator because it is a single EPC contract: Sinoma CBMI is delivering design, equipment supply, construction, installation, and commissioning for USD 250 million. Sebit, at USD 345 million for a 6,000 t/day site commissioned in April 2024, shows how site works and phasing stretch an investment figure above the bare contract price. Moroto sits between them and carries a second phase still to build, since the site is designed for 2Mt of clinker and 3Mt of cement a year at full operation.

Treat all three as indicative brackets. They price whole plants, from crusher to packing; the pyroprocessing island alone is a minority share of any of these figures, and a retrofit scope is smaller again. Only a sized quote can say by how much.

What a kiln and preheater budget actually contains

A quote for “a kiln line” covers four equipment blocks, and buyers who itemize them negotiate better. The preheater tower with its cyclone stages does the raw-meal heating. The precalciner takes most of the fuel and does most of the calcination. The kiln tube, with its drive, girth gear, tyres, and support stations, finishes the clinker reaction. The cooler recovers heat into combustion air and sets the downstream power bill.

Around those blocks sit the items that surprise first-time budgeters: the main burner, the refractory lining for the whole hot line, tower steelwork and foundations, dust filtration, and the control layer. Refractories deserve their own line because they recur; the first fill in the equipment contract starts a permanent operating cost, not a one-off.

The practical budgeting method is a stack, not a sticker price: equipment blocks, erection and civils, freight and inland haulage, first-fill refractories and spares, then financing and tax lines. Ugandan projects move the middle of that stack more than most markets.

What moves the price in Uganda specifically

Capacity is the first driver everywhere: 6,000 t/day is the scale both regional integrated builds chose. The second driver is fuel. A calciner and burner specified for flexible or alternative fuels costs more upfront and pays back through the life of the plant, an argument that lands in Uganda because thermal fuel is imported and priced in dollars.

The third driver is the site, and this is where Uganda diverges from its neighbours. Moroto sits in the Karamoja sub-region in the northeast, on the limestone but far from the established industrial and rail node at Tororo. Remote sites raise the civils, camp, and erection share of the budget. Uganda’s older integrated kiln lines at Kasese and Tororo sit on better-served corridors, which is one reason retrofit work there prices tighter than greenfield work in Karamoja.

The fourth driver is raw-material chemistry. Each limestone deposit burns differently, and a supplier who requests the quarry chemistry before quoting a preheater configuration is pricing the real duty rather than a catalogue duty. Push every bidder to ask.

Freight and installation: the landlocked premium

Uganda has no port. Kiln shells, tyres, and cooler modules land at Mombasa as breakbulk or out-of-gauge cargo and move up the Northern Corridor by road, crossing at Malaba or Busia, with abnormal-load permits and escort convoys for the heaviest sections. That inland leg is a genuine budget line in its own right, and it grows with distance past Kampala. For a Karamoja site it includes road survey and reinforcement works that coastal projects never see.

Rail relief is coming but not bookable. The Malaba-Kampala standard gauge railway is in early construction, so every current kiln project prices full road haulage. A vendor who quotes CIF Mombasa and leaves the corridor to the buyer has not quoted the Ugandan price.

Erection and commissioning then run long. A pyro line is welded, refractory-lined, aligned, and dried out on site, and kiln commissioning extends months past mechanical completion. Tie the retention release to performance tests, and expect suppliers to price supervision man-months accordingly.

Duties, VAT deferment, and the discharge deadline

The tax side is friendlier than the freight side. Plant and machinery enters Uganda at zero duty under the EAC Common External Tariff, and the 2025 external-trade amendments took the 1% import declaration fee and the 1.5% infrastructure levy off HS 84 and 85 machinery.

That leaves 18% VAT as the one large border line, and a VAT-registered manufacturer can defer it at importation. The discharge mechanics have real deadlines. URA requires the discharge application within 28 days after the deferment period ends, supported by photos of the installed machinery, and follows it with a physical inspection to confirm the equipment matches the deferment. A taxpayer not yet making taxable supplies can apply for an extension.

On a kiln project, map the deferment calendar against the erection schedule at contract stage so the inspection lands after the machinery is actually standing.

Who supplies, and how the supplier chain sets the budget shape

Uganda’s one greenfield precedent is Chinese-integrated end to end. Yaobai is a West China Cement subsidiary and built Moroto through its own group engineering chain, the same pattern as Sinoma CBMI’s turnkey position at Kwale. Chinese packages arrive with financing attached and compete hard on capex, which is why they win East African greenfields.

The European route prices differently and enters differently. Germany’s pyroprocessing houses, thyssenkrupp Polysius with 800 cement plants built worldwide, KHD Humboldt Wedag, and IKN on the cooler side, compete through equipment packages inside EPC-led builds and through retrofit scopes bought directly by plant owners, arguing fuel flexibility, cooler recuperation, and lifetime operating cost against the capex headline. The supplier field also consolidated recently: FLSmidth completed the sale of its cement business to Pacific Avenue Capital Partners in October 2025 and now concentrates on mining, so legacy FLSmidth kiln references sit with a private-equity-owned successor.

For a Ugandan buyer the budget consequence is simple. A Chinese turnkey minimizes the capital number and bundles the decisions. A European package or retrofit costs more per tonne of capacity upfront and argues its case in fuel and power savings over fifteen years. Price both against Uganda’s dollar-linked fuel bill, which favours the efficiency case more than a first-cost comparison shows.

Paying for it: UGX, letters of credit, and ECA cover

Quote in dollars or euros and leave shilling exposure with the buyer. The shilling is a market-determined float, smoothed by the Bank of Uganda, and capital-goods importers have faced no hard-currency allocation queues in 2026. Letters of credit at kiln-package scale are issued by Stanbic, Absa, Standard Chartered’s corporate desk, dfcu, or Centenary; on a large scope the confirming bank abroad matters as much as the issuing bank, so name both in the offer.

Export-credit cover follows the equipment’s origin. Sinosure sits behind Chinese kiln packages, and that financing is part of why the Chinese chain wins greenfields. German and Italian suppliers bring Euler Hermes or SACE cover, which Ugandan borrowers accept readily because ECA-backed tenors price below commercial debt.

The milestone shape is familiar: a down payment secured by guarantee, document-based payments as equipment ships, and a retention that only releases at performance testing. On a kiln line that retention can sit outstanding for well over a year, so price the cost of carrying it into the bid rather than discovering it at commissioning.

Can I sell a preheater or cooler upgrade in Uganda without bidding a full kiln line?

Yes, and the retrofit lane is the more open one. Uganda’s older integrated lines at Kasese and Tororo buy burner, cyclone, refractory, and cooler work directly, with no EPC in the middle. Those scopes are planned around scheduled kiln shutdowns, so the vendor who engages before the shutdown calendar is set wins the order.

How long does a Ugandan kiln project run from contract to clinker?

Regional greenfields have run on roughly two-year windows from EPC signing to commissioning, and remote sites trend longer once haulage and civils are counted. Retrofit scopes move on a different clock, measured in weeks around a planned shutdown. Budget supplier supervision through performance testing, not just to mechanical completion.

Do kiln equipment suppliers need PAU National Supplier Database registration?

Not for selling to cement producers. NSD registration at nsd.pau.go.ug is a legal precondition only for supplying Uganda’s oil and gas chain. A kiln or preheater vendor whose equipment serves a cement plant needs no NSD entry, though the wider e-GP system applies if a state entity is the buyer.

Who buys rotary kilns in Uganda besides cement plants?

Lime burning and mineral processing generate smaller calcination scopes, and Uganda’s raw-mineral export restrictions gradually pull more thermal processing onshore. For budget purposes, though, cement anchors the ticket sizes: Moroto’s build-out and the retrofit pool at the incumbent plants are where the material money moves.
